This case arose out of a two-vehicle accident that occurred on December 4, 1987 at approximately 1:25 p.m. on Route 17K in Newburgh, New York. Deborah Contini was driving her 1987 Hyundai Excel. Her infant son, Thomas, was seated behind her in the back seat in a Fisher Price child restraint seat.
